summaryrefslogtreecommitdiff
path: root/sys
diff options
context:
space:
mode:
Diffstat (limited to 'sys')
-rw-r--r--sys/dev/usb/uftdi.c17
-rw-r--r--sys/dev/usb/usbdevs6
2 files changed, 21 insertions, 2 deletions
diff --git a/sys/dev/usb/uftdi.c b/sys/dev/usb/uftdi.c
index 78f6567815a..d0fe7fc7c65 100644
--- a/sys/dev/usb/uftdi.c
+++ b/sys/dev/usb/uftdi.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: uftdi.c,v 1.17 2004/08/13 22:13:55 deraadt Exp $ */
+/* $OpenBSD: uftdi.c,v 1.18 2004/10/30 14:36:28 deraadt Exp $ */
/* $NetBSD: uftdi.c,v 1.14 2003/02/23 04:20:07 simonb Exp $ */
/*
@@ -154,6 +154,9 @@ USB_MATCH(uftdi)
(uaa->product == USB_PRODUCT_INTREPIDCS_VALUECAN ||
uaa->product == USB_PRODUCT_INTREPIDCS_NEOVI))
return (UMATCH_VENDOR_PRODUCT);
+ if (uaa->vendor == USB_VENDOR_BBELECTRONICS &&
+ (uaa->product == USB_PRODUCT_BBELECTRONICS_USOTL4))
+ return (UMATCH_VENDOR_PRODUCT);
return (UMATCH_NONE);
}
@@ -242,6 +245,18 @@ USB_ATTACH(uftdi)
sc->sc_type = UFTDI_TYPE_8U232AM;
sc->sc_hdrlen = 0;
break;
+
+ default: /* Can't happen */
+ goto bad;
+ }
+ break;
+
+ case USB_VENDOR_BBELECTRONICS:
+ switch( uaa->product ){
+ case USB_PRODUCT_BBELECTRONICS_USOTL4:
+ sc->sc_type = UFTDI_TYPE_8U232AM;
+ sc->sc_hdrlen = 0;
+ break;
default: /* Can't happen */
goto bad;
}
diff --git a/sys/dev/usb/usbdevs b/sys/dev/usb/usbdevs
index 39b133a4595..397d32ce84a 100644
--- a/sys/dev/usb/usbdevs
+++ b/sys/dev/usb/usbdevs
@@ -1,4 +1,4 @@
-$OpenBSD: usbdevs,v 1.117 2004/10/26 00:25:51 jsg Exp $
+$OpenBSD: usbdevs,v 1.118 2004/10/30 14:36:28 deraadt Exp $
/* $NetBSD: usbdevs,v 1.322 2003/05/10 17:47:14 hamajima Exp $ */
/*
@@ -290,6 +290,7 @@ vendor ACCTON 0x083a Accton Technology
vendor DIAMOND 0x0841 Diamond
vendor NETGEAR 0x0846 BayNETGEAR
vendor ACTIVEWIRE 0x0854 ActiveWire
+vendor BBELECTRONICS 0x0856 B&B Electronics
vendor PORTGEAR 0x085a PortGear
vendor NETGEAR2 0x0864 Netgear
vendor SYSTEMTALKS 0x086e System Talks
@@ -563,6 +564,9 @@ product AVERATEC USBWLAN 0x4013 WLAN
/* Avision products */
product AVISION 1200U 0x0268 1200U
+/* B&B Electronics products */
+product BBELECTRONICS USOTL4 0xAC01 uLinks RS-422/485
+
/* Belkin products */
/*product BELKIN F5U111 0x???? F5U111 Ethernet */
product BELKIN2 F5U002 0x0002 F5U002 Parallel